  • Triumph Speed Twin STD BS VI vs Bajaj Pulsar 200 NS ABS BS VI – Which model is Cheapest?

    The ex-showroom price of the Bajaj Pulsar NS200 in New Delhi starts at ₹ 1.57 Lakh and goes up to ₹ 1.69 Lakh for the fully-loaded model. On the other hand, Triumph Speed Twin price in New Delhi of base variant starts at ₹ 10.99 Lakh

  • Triumph Speed Twin STD BS VI vs Bajaj Pulsar 200 NS ABS BS VI – Which gives Better Mileage?

    As for the claimed fuel efficiency, the Bajaj Pulsar NS200 base engine returns 40 KM/L. The Triumph Speed Twin base returns 21 KM/L
